Loose barges on La. Intercoastal


Coast Guard Sector New Orleans received a report Tuesday night (Dec. 12) that the uninspected towing vessel Native Dancer’s lead starboard barge collided with a concrete barrier on the Intracoastal Waterway (mile marker 57.5) near Houma, La. Six barges broke loose. Three have been secured. The waterway is closed in the vicinity. CG Marine Safety Unit Houma is investigating. The CG launched a 29-foot response boat out of Morgan City, La., to assist with IW traffic. There have been no reports of pollution or injuries. (Source: Coast Guard 12/12/17)
